Abstract

The present invention relates to the field of radio frequency, and provides a band-gap reference self-starting circuit and a passive radio frequency identification tag. The self-starting circuit comprises: a first switch device unit, configured to generate a first leakage current in an off state; a second switch device unit, configured to generate a second leakage current lower than the first leakage current in the off state, and generate a control voltage according to the first leakage current and the second leakage current; a control unit, configured to generate a starting control signal according to the control voltage; and a band-gap reference generating unit, configured to generate a reference voltage according to the starting control signal, and control the second switch device unit to enter dormancy using the reference voltage. The present invention boosts the control voltage using the leakage current generated by a field effect transistor in the off state, thereby implementing self-starting and generating the reference voltage, and controls the starting control unit to enter dormancy after the reference voltage is generated, thereby reducing system power consumption.
